Pros: Scent, very moisturizing and slick
Cons: Brushless
Tin is 6 oz (approx. 3" dia by 2" high) with an almost liquid consistency. Cost was $15
Scent is very pleasant - like clove in hot apple cider at a local Cider Mill. Scent lingers after rinsing.
Label says for brush and finger application, but I aksed at the Barber Shop (Birmingham MI) where it was developed and they said brushless.
I tried it first brushless and it was very effective - had to keep adding moisture to activate it as it dries quickly (or maybe I shave slowly!). Second time I used a brush and it helped apply the cream. Rinsed cleanly, although using a brush does use a lot more product and it just gets rinsed down the sink drain. The only low score I gave the product was for latherability - but it was not designed for brush lathering, so that may not be fair.
While I am not a fan of using a brushless cream at home, I think this product would be great poured into a smaller (sample size) tub for travel.
